Black Pepper Chicken
Ingredients
Method
- In a bowl, marinate the chicken pieces in 2 tablespoons of soy sauce, 1 tablespoon of oyster sauce, and cornstarch for about 15-20 minutes.
- Heat the vegetable oil in a large pan over medium-high heat. Add the marinated chicken and stir-fry until cooked through. Remove the chicken from the pan and set aside.
- In the same pan, add a little more oil if needed and sauté the onion, bell pepper, and garlic until fragrant and slightly softened.
- Add the crushed black peppercorns, 1 tablespoon of soy sauce, 1 tablespoon of oyster sauce, and sugar to the pan. Stir well to combine.
- Pour in the chicken broth and bring to a simmer. Add the cooked chicken back to the pan and stir to coat the chicken with the sauce.
- Let the dish simmer for a few more minutes until the sauce thickens slightly.
- Serve the Black Pepper Chicken hot, garnished with sliced green onions.
